    Job Description

    • Handle commercial litigation matters in Texas state and federal courts.
    • Take ownership of litigation files from pleadings and discovery through motion practice, settlement negotiations, mediation, and trial preparation.
    • Draft pleadings, motions, briefs, discovery requests, discovery responses, and legal correspondence.
    • Develop case strategy, evaluate risk, and help guide clients through complex business disputes.
    • Attend hearings, depositions, mediations, court conferences, and other litigation proceedings.
    • Work directly with partners, clients, opposing counsel, courts, and internal team members.
    • Manage deadlines, discovery, case calendars, and litigation strategy with a high level of professionalism and independence.
    • Work on matters involving business disputes, contracts, financial institutions, creditor rights, real estate, construction, oil and gas, and other commercial litigation issues.
    • Support trial preparation and participate in courtroom advocacy as appropriate.

    Qualifications

    • Active Texas Bar license required.
    • 5+ years of litigation experience required.
    • Commercial litigation experience strongly preferred.
    • Experience handling litigation matters in Texas state and/or federal court.
    • Strong legal research, writing, drafting, analytical, and case management skills.
    • Ability to manage a docket with appropriate independence while collaborating with partners and team members.
    • Experience with banking, creditor-side litigation, bankruptcy-adjacent matters, financial institutions, or complex business disputes is preferred.
